Thomas Edison1847 1931
  • Only attended formal school
  • for a few months
  • Taught by his mother
  • At 13 sold newspapers and
  • candy on a local train line
  • Obtained 1093 patents
  • during his life

3
Thomas Edison1847 1931
  • His first successful invention was
  • to improve the stock ticker
  • First great invention was the tin foil phonograph
    which recorded sound
  • First demonstrated the electric
  • light in 1879
  • Invented the kinetoscope
  • or motion picture camera

George Eastman1854 - 1932
  • He quit school at 14 to help support his family
  • He was paid 3 a week to be a
  • messenger boy
  • He was a well known philanthropist
  • and gave away 100 million

5
George Eastman1854 - 1932
  • He invented easy use cameras
  • And dry, transparent film on rolls
  • His inventions made it possible
  • for Thomas Edisons motion
  • picture camera

Philo T. Farnsworth1906 - 1971
  • Born in a log cabin in Beaver, Utah
  • His parents wanted him to become
  • a concert violinist
  • He once worked on a Salt Lake
  • City street cleaning crew

7
Philo T. Farnsworth1906 - 1971
  • September 7, 1927 first components of
  • the television were demonstrated
  • He invented the first electron
  • microscope and the first
  • infant incubator
  • Electronic eyes he invented
  • were used in moon landings

Bill William Lear1902 1978
  • Went to school through the 8th grade
  • During WW1, at 16 he joined the Navy
  • After the war he became a pilot
  • At the age of 20 he formed his
  • first of many companies

9
Bill William Lear1902 1978
  • Invented the first practical car radio
  • Invented a reliable aeronautical radio compass
    and automatic pilot system
  • Invented the eight track tape
  • with endless magnetic loop
  • recording

Stephanie Kwolek1923 - present
  • Wanted to go to medical school, but lack the
    funds
  • Took a research position
  • with DuPont
  • Worked hard so her job
  • wouldnt be given to a man

11
Stephanie Kwolek1923 - present
  • In the 1960s discover crystalline polymers
  • Material used in bulletproof vests
  • Also used in radial tires, brake pads,
  • racing sails, fiberoptic cable,
  • water-, air-, and spacecraft shells
